      Should be called rattle class

      by Hasa on Tuesday, August 05, 2025

      Pros: Interior design is elegant. The screen is crisp and responsive. Steering wheel is smooth Cons: -Persistent Rattles: From the backseat to the seatbelt pillar, noises emerge over bumps and uneven roads. -Steering Wheel Noise: A leather-like cracking sound when turning the wheel -Underbody clanking: The most frustrating issue is an unmistakable rattle or clank from underneath the car, over speed bumps and when driving at ~30 mph on imperfect roads. It sounds like a loose part and is driving me crazy. -Initial diagnosis pointed to the right front strut, which was replaced but the noise persisted. - A trusted dealer later identified the heat shields as the source of the clanking. Apparently, this is a known issue with the platform. I drove 2 loaners, a 2025 CLE and a 2025 C-class and both had the exact same clanking noise. Mercedes seems to have traded build quality for digital flair, and the result is disappointing. I’m eagerly awaiting the registration papers just to sell it and likely switching to a BMW 330i
